Education official seeks action against male teachers over 'harassment'.

KOHAT -- The sub-divisional education officer (female) has demanded action against three male teachers under the Harassment at Workplace Act allegedly for hurling threats at her after she refused to revise a proposal for rationalisation of female primary schoolteachers.

In a letter addressed to the district education office (male), a copy of which is also available with Dawn, Ms Asifa said she had prepared a list of rationalisation of primary schoolteachers on Jan 13, 2021, which was approved by the DEO.

She said on Jan 26, when she was in the DEO office (female), the three male teachers from different schools threatened her of consequences if she did not revise the list.

In the letter also addressed to the directorate of education, she said the teachers were putting pressure on her through their cronies in the education department and in political circles.

She also warned of filing a defamation case against them for publishing a concocted story to defame her in a local newspaper if action was not taken against them.

When contacted, district education officer (female), Rizwana Liaquat, clarified that she had no knowledge of any such case. If the victim had any grievance she should have sent a complaint directly to her.
